Security enhancement of handover key management based on media access control address in 4G LTE networks

The fourth generation (4G) network is new wireless technology that offers much advancement to the wireless market. In 4G, the forward key separation plays a vital role in handover process and it can be vulnerable due to the presence of rogue base stations. Periodically updating the root key stored in base stations reduces the consequence of the attacks. But, the selection of the best possible key update interval is a vague issue as it is difficult to achieve stability between the degree of the exposed messages and the signalling load. To attack the service of websites, competitors sign up into the website multiple times and degrade the performance of the web server. Hence, this paper proposes a method that maintains history/status tables to keep a record of the media access control address in an intranet environment. The unique addresses, the media access control and internet protocol addresses are maintained in the status tables and used to identify each node distinctly. The proposed system guarantees authenticity of the host connected in the environment. Finally, the performance analysis shows that our proposed system provides better security and significant reduction in latency.
